When checking a malfunction, find the cause of the problem. If it is determined that removal and/or disassembly is necessary, perform the work by following the procedures contained in this manual.
   
If punch marks or mating marks are made to avoid error in assembly and facilitate the assembly work, be sure to make them in locations which will have no detrimental effect on performance and/or appearance. If an area having many parts, similar parts, and/or parts which are symmetrical right and left is disassembled, be sure to arrange the parts so that they do not become mixed during the assembly process.
  1. Arrange the parts removed in the proper order.
  1. Determine which parts are to be reused and which are to be replaced.
  1. If bolts, nuts, etc., are to be replaced, be sure to use only the exact size specified.
